Biased GRK Signaling Via β2-Adrenergic Receptors in Human Skeletal Muscle
Starting soon · Phase 2
Conditions studied: Overweight and Obesity
In brief
This longitudinal mechanistic physiological study examines biased β2-adrenergic receptor (β2-AR) signaling in human skeletal muscle, with emphasis on G protein-coupled receptor kinase (GRK)-mediated pathways. Participants will receive daily oral dosing of the GRK-selective long-acting β2-agonist ATR-258 for 8 weeks. Muscle biopsies and physiological measurements will quantify GRK-, cAMP/PKA-, and β-arrestin-related signaling, fiber-type specificity, and potential receptor desensitization with repeated stimulation.

Who can join
Age: 21 and older, up to 45. Sex: male. Healthy volunteers: accepted.
You may qualify if…
- Healthy men
- Age 21-45 years
- BMI 25-35 kg/m\^2
- Body fat percentage 25-40%
- Lean Mass Index 14-22
You may not qualify if…
- Regular use of or allergy to β2-agonists
- Serious adverse reactions to β2-agonists
- Current smoker
- Regular use of medication (except OTC allergy or analgesics)
- Abnormal ECG before or after β2-AR stimulation
- Hypertension
- Reduced kidney function (eGFR < 90 ml/min/1.73m\^2)
- Cardiovascular, metabolic, gastrointestinal, renal, or pulmonary disease
- Psychiatric or neurological disorders affecting compliance/safety reporting
- Cancer history within the last 5 years
- Substance abuse or alcohol intake >14 units/week
